[0003] In the cutting process of corrugated cardboard, a cutting machine is usually used. The existing corrugated cardboard has a low degree of automation in the cutting and cutting process. It is necessary to manually take out the cut cardboard during cutting, and the fibers and particles produced by cutting It cannot be collected and processed well, and it will cause harm to the health of operators, so it needs to be improved

Abstract

The invention relates to a corrugated cardboard cutting production line, which comprises a base and two symmetrically arranged support frames vertically fixed on the upper end surface of the base. The positioning plate of the cutting assembly is provided with a discharge port on the support frame. The cutting assembly includes two cantilever supports arranged on the lower surface of the positioning plate and a motor arranged on one of the cantilever supports. The motor shaft of the motor is provided with a driving wheel. A driven wheel is arranged on a cantilever bracket, and the driving wheel and the driven wheel are connected through a belt transmission. A cutting knife assembly capable of cutting corrugated cardboard is arranged on the belt, and a dust suction assembly for absorbing dust is arranged under the positioning plate. The whole process has a high degree of automation, high processing efficiency, and reduces physical hazards to operators.

technical field [0001] The invention relates to a corrugated cardboard cutting production line and a production method thereof. Background technique [0002] Corrugated carton is the most widely used packaging product, and its consumption has always been the first among all kinds of packaging products. Including calcium plastic corrugated box. For more than half a century, corrugated boxes have gradually replaced wooden boxes and other transportation packaging containers due to their superior performance and good processing performance, and have become the main force of transportation packaging. In addition to protecting the goods and facilitating storage and transportation, it also plays the role of beautifying and promoting the goods. Corrugated boxes are green and environmentally friendly products, which are conducive to environmental protection and are conducive to loading, unloading and transportation.
